"In steam systems that have not been maintained for 3 to 5 years, between 15% to 30% of the installed steam traps may have failed—thus allowing live steam to escape into the condensate return system."  - U.S. Department of Energy

Steam System Evaluation

Includes a comprehensive Steam Trap Survey with the latest Infrared (Thermal) and Ultrasonic technologies to accurately identify steam trap failures and various other issues impacting your steam and condensate systems operation.  STEAMGARD will also provide technical troubleshooting and review the operating conditions of all the steam-utilizing equipment and the auxiliary infrastructure to ensure the highest level of performance can be achieved and maintained.  Our findings and recommendations are put together into a comprehensive engineering report.

According to the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E), approximately 50% of all the fuel burned by U.S. manufacturers is consumed to generate steam.

 

DOE estimates that 20% of the steam leaving a central boiler plant is lost by "leaking" steam traps in typical steam systems without proactive steam trap assessment programs or testing.

 

Independent studies suggest that the typical service-life of mechanical steam traps is approximately 2 - 5 years, with failures occurring randomly and frequently.
